These datasheets are used in numerous applications. For example, let’s consider a scenario where you need to select one of eight different sensor readings to feed into a microcontroller. The 74151, guided by a three-bit select code, efficiently routes the chosen sensor data to the output. Here’s a basic step-by-step of how datasheets are applied:

  1. Review the datasheet to confirm that the IC 74151 operates at the required voltage level.
  2. Use the pinout diagram from the datasheet to correctly connect the select lines (A, B, C) and data inputs (D0-D7).
  3. Refer to the truth table to determine which select line combination will output the desired data line.
  4. Check the timing specifications in the datasheet (propagation delay) to ensure the circuit is functioning within the speed requirements.
